The User Agent is a string of text telling me various information about the browser that sent the form.
An example of a User Agent would beMoz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.1; en-US; rv:1.8) Gecko/20051111 Firefox/1.5. What this tells me is that the browser is Firefox 1.5 with the US English localisation, running on Windows XP.
There is more information in that user agent string, such as the build version of the rendering engine (the Gecko bit), as well as the cipher capability of the browser (the U bit).Most of this information, however, is not available in most other user agent strings, so most of this information is ignored by me.
